The AP061C series is a series of high-precision voltage detectors developed using CMOS process. The detection voltage is fixed internally with an accuracy of ±2.0%. Two output forms, Nch open-drain and CMOS output, are available. Ultra-low current consumption and miniature package lineup can meet demand from the portable device applications. Applications B.
Ultra-low current consumption 0.8 μA typ. (Vin=1.5V)
High-precision detection voltage ±2.0 %
Operating voltage range 0.7 V to 8 V
Detection voltage 1.5 V to 6.0 V (0.1 V step)
Output form Nch open-drain output (Active Low)
or CMOS output (Active Low)
Small package: SOT23-3
